The University of Huelva is a young dynamic institution, striving for excellenceand a brilliant future for its 13.000 students. Our motto is Sapere Aude – Dare toKnow. Since the university gained its independence from Seville University in1993 it has continued to grow and we now have a brand new campus withmodern facilities and installations. Students can choose from a wide range ofboth undergraduate and postgraduate degrees and diplomas within our schoolsand faculties with an increasing number of subjects taught in English. The University is spread over four sites. The main and newest campus is ElCarmen, to the north of the city where the Faculties of Experimental Sciences, Law, Humanities, Education Sciences,Labour Sciences, the School of Nursing and the School of Social Work can be found as well as state of the art computingfacilities and the central library. The Faculty of Business Science is housed in a building of architectural merit next to thecathedral in the heart of the city centre and is known as La Merced. The Polytechnic is strategically located to the west atLa Rabida, high on a hill overlooking the Tinto estuary and the city’s industrial areas where strong links have been formedwith the University. The University General Registry and administrative centre is located in Cantero Cuadrado.
